Describe the bug
Not able to click on anything besides the tabs to select the channel and delete that channel. (Not able to close the application, click settings, login, minimize, or click to maximize).

Able to add splits but I cannot interact with the UI that pops up to specify the split. However, I can remove splits and interact with the prompt that pops up asking for confirmation.

As far as I know, I am able to type in the chat if I could login due to the fact that I can type in the text box.

In terms of looks, everything is zoomed in and the text is blurry. Saw something similar to that visually when I was looking for solutions but did not see a fix for it. Emotes are working fine as far as I can tell.

To reproduce
Launching the application (administrator mode or not).

Screenshots
image

Chatterino version
Tried version 2.2.2-fix and 2.2.4-beta2. The application worked awhile ago and I was using it all the time but I am not sure of the version that I was using. It broke when I was using that version so I am not sure it would make a difference anyway.

Operating system
Windows 10 (Latest updates)

Additional information
Noticed the issue after I ran the application on my vertical monitor awhile ago. Not sure if this is related in any way. Does not work on either monitor now.

Main monitor: 3840 x 2160
Vertical monitor: 1080 x 1920

Sounds like a DPI issue. What DPI are both monitors set to? Chatterino works just fine vertically for me:

I went in and changed the scaling from 150% on my main monitor to 100% and it worked on both monitors. I changed it back without closing the program and it kept working. However, if I keep it at 150% and close the app then re-open it, the same issue arises.

It's not a really big deal, but it would be annoying to have to change the scaling from 150% to 100% and back again when I want to use the app.
